Request for Information (RFI) is a NRC inspection process for asking questions. During inspections the NRC inspector will make RFI in order to review whatever is necessary to fulfill the inspection objectives.

The first RFI may be in the form of a letter or email list. But RFI can also be any verbal request made on site in the course of the on-site inspection week.
